## Deploying the Gatewick Proctor Queue

Deploys are pretty painless: push to main, wait for the pipeline, then watch the queue drain dashboard for five minutes. If candidates pile up mid-exam, roll back first and ask questions later — the queue replays safely. Everything the workers care about lives in one config block, shown here for reference.

settings of bafof-yagef:
JOROX_PIN=8740
JOROX_TENANT=pelox
JOROX_METRICS_HOST=metrics.jorox.qorvelworks.internal
JOROX_SEAL=seal_c78f63c1
JOROX_STANDBY_TEAM=norax

Handover: cron drift on Meridel schedulers

For support: the nightly jobs on the Meridel batch hosts have been drifting 3–7 minutes since the clocksync agent upgrade. I've pinned the agent back and added drift alerts; Tormas picks this up Monday. No data loss observed — jobs ran late, not skipped. If tickets come in, point users at the status page.

The scheduler currently runs with the configuration values listed here.

settings of fafog-haduf:
ZORIX_PIN=4648
ZORIX_METRICS_HOST=metrics.zorix.paliqsys.corp
ZORIX_LOG_LEVEL=info
ZORIX_TENANT=druix

Handover for the eng sync: I've been profiling template rendering in Quillforge after the Pemberton catalog pages crossed 400ms p95. Root cause is repeated partial compilation per request; the fix is a warm compile cache keyed on template hash, which Ines prototyped and cut latency roughly in half. Remaining work: cache invalidation on deploy and memory cap tuning. Benchmarks, flame graphs, and open questions are all collected on this internal page:

runbook for badug-kadup: https://confluence.zemvarlabs.internal/projects/browse/display/projects/bd1b

# Wavelet Preview Service — Environments

Wavelet generates audio waveform previews for the Chorusline uploader. Three environments: dev, staging, prod. Dev uses shared storage; staging and prod are isolated per-tenant. No PII in payloads; previews are derived artifacts only. Transcoding workers run unprivileged. Staging mirrors prod topology minus the CDN edge. Access is role-gated; review scope should focus on the render sandbox. Current prod configuration for the service is as follows.

service settings:
novath:
  pin: 1396
  tenant: pelys
  seal: seal_ccc035e1
  metrics_host: metrics.novath.qorvelworks.test
  standby_team: fraeth
  escalation: drueth-zorok
  nonce: 61d508